ANALYSIS OF THE FINITE VERB PHRASES IN THE SHORT STORIES THE GIFT OF THE MAGI AND COSMOPOLITE IN A CAFÉ BY O. HENRY Aulia, Rima Fitri; Suyudi, Ichwan

Abstract

This research focused on finding the types of finite verb and main verbs. The researcher used the short stories The Gift of The Magi and Cosmopolite in a Café by O.Henry to limit the finding data. The method of this research is qualitative research. The result of this research showed that there are 361 finite verb phrases and divided into two types of finite verbs, 1. Main verbs stand alone which occur mostly with 65.93%, 2. Auxiliaries stand with the main verb with 34.07% which may be modal (29.27%), passive (18.70%), perfective (24.39%), progressive (6.50%), combination of two auxiliaries (12.20%), and the negative do- periphrasis auxiliary (8.94%). Based on 361 datas of finite verb phrases, the researcher found the most dominant type of main verb is action verb with 62.05% and stative verb with 37.95%.

FIGURATIVE LANGUAGE ANALYSIS ON THE UGLY LOVE NOVEL BY COLLEEN HOOVER Tiarawati, Arini Egi; Ningsih, Tri Wahyu Retno

Abstract

The aim of this study is to analyze the types of figurative language which found in Ugly Love novel by Colleen Hoover. This study used figurative language theory by Leech to analyze the data which the researcher found in the novel. The method of this study is  descriptive qualitative method.  The total of the data are 87 data to be analyzed in the types of figurative language. The data will be identify and classify into 8 types of figurative language by Leech. The result of this study found 6 types of figurative language in this Ugly Love novel. That are 33 data of personifications (33 data) , 19 data of similes, 11 data of irony, 10 data of hyperbole, 9 data of metaphors, and 5 data of metonymy. The most of dominant type of figurative language in the Ugly Love novel by Colleen Hoover is personification.
THE IMPACTS OF BULLYING EXPERIENCED BY DAELYN RICE IN THE NOVEL “BY THE TIME YOU READ THIS I’LL BE DEAD” Salsabila, Putri Aghitstha

Abstract

This research is about the impacts of bullying in Julie Anne Peters’s novel entitled By The Time You Read This I’ll be Dead. The purposes of this research are to identify the kinds of bullying and investigate the impacts of bullying experienced by the main character, Daelyn Rice. Researcher used qualitative methods. Researcher used two data sources: primary and secondary. Primary data is By The Time You Read This I’ll be Dead novel by Julie Anne Peters. The sources of secondary data are taken from other sources related the research, such as website, dictionary, and some books which support this research. The results of this research show: 1) Daelyn Rice has three kinds of bullying experienced, that are: Physical bullying, Verbal bullying, and Psychological or Social bullying. 2) Daelyn Rice has four impacts of bullying experienced, that are: Academic impact, Social impact, Psychological impact and Physical impact.
AN ANALYSIS OF ENGLISH PHRASAL VERB TYPES FOUND IN MAROON 5’S ALBUM SONG ABOUT JANE (2002) AND THEIR TRANSLATION TECHNIQUES S.Y, Annisa; Nurlaila, Nurlaila

Abstract

Phrasal verb is combination of a verb and a preposition or an adverb that is used together and creates a new meaning. The aim of the research is to find out types of English phrasal verb that are used in maroon 5’s album Song About Jane (2002), to find out types of English phrasal verb that  are used the most frequently and to find out translation techniques that are applied in translating English phrasal verb in Maroon 5’s album Song About Jane (2002) in English-Indonesian version. The data that is used is the words that contain phrasal verb in lyrics song and the source of data is Maroon 5’s Album Song About Jane (2002). This research is descriptive qualitative. This qualitative research uses expert validation to check the validity of the data and research results. The researcher identifies the data of phrasal verb based on King and Richard’s theory (2006) and identifies the translation techniques that are used based on Molina and Albir’s theory (2002). The results of the research show that there are three (3) types of phrasal verb that are found in Maron 5’s Album Song About Jane (2002), those are : separable obligatory phrasal verb 26% (10 of 38), inseparable phrasal verb 34% (13 of 38) and intransitive phrasal verb 40% (15 of 38), type of English phrasal verb that are used the most frequently in Maroon 5’s album Song About Jane (2002) is intransitive phrasal verb with 15 data, and there are 3 techniques that are used in translating english phrasal verb in maroon 5’s album Song About Jane (2002), those are : generalization 87% (33 of 38), established equivalent 10% ( 4 of 38)and discursive creation 3% (1 of 38).
CRITIQUE OF IDEOLOGY BIN GEORGE ORWELL’S NOVEL 1984: A HANS-GEORG GADAMER’S HERMENEUTICS READING Fajri, Daniel Ahmad; Noverino, Romel

Abstract

This study is to analyze George Orwell’s novel 1984 that published in 1949. This study uses descriptive qualitative method. The analysis of this undergraduate thesis focuses on hermeneutical reading of the text. This study aims to find out critique of ideology concept by reading both the text and the researcher (as interpreter) horizons to get a current meaning of the text. This study applies philosophical hermeneutics of Hans-Georg Gadamer and Jurgen Habermas’s critical theory to analyze the novel. After interprets the horizon of the text with three stages of analysis (understanding, historical consciousness, and history of effect), then the prejudice/presupposition (Habermas’ critique of ideology) appear dialectically as interpreter horizon to read the 1984 in its current context. The result proves that, although the work of structure of power in Orwell's life and interpreter are different - Orwell who live in the tension of world ideologies (with fascism, soviet communism, and other totalitarian power) and interpreter in the late-capitalism era (with liberal consensus domination), but analysis of critique of ideology in the 1984 novel in the current context relates to several things. Among other things are, total domination of the system like distorting symbolic interactions and how power works supported - manifested in high-level technology with its propaganda and supervision of civil society. At this point, to resist against totalitarian system, both Orwell and Habermas are similar as well - a process of rationalization with a communication paradigm with emancipatory mission to give a progressive free individual formation in the society.
SWEARING ANALYSIS OF CHARACTERS IN DEADPOOL MOVIE Wulandari, Tasya; Firmawan, Hendro

Abstract

This research focuses to identify the types and the reasons of swearing for characters of Deadpool movie. It uses a qualitative method to analyzing the data that are found. It finds 81 data of types of swearing, and 83 data of reasons of swearing out of 83 data. The data of this research are in the form of sentences, words spoken by the characters. This research finds that the types of swearing uttered by the characters of Deadpool movie can be classified into five types, there are, Dyphemistic Swearing (DS), Abusive Swearing (AS), Idiomatic Swearing (IS), Emphatic Swearing (ES), and Cathartic Swearing (CS). In addition, it also found the the reason of swearing that is consist of three motives. There are, Psychological motives (PM), Social Motives (SM), and Linguistic Motives (LM). From this research, it can be concluded that emphatic swearing is the most used swearing expression and psychological motives is the most dominant reasons spoken by the characters.
